Hi my name is May and I am a lampwork artist. I live in Texas with my family and all my pets. I have been lampworking for about 2 years and have been stringing beads for the past 3 years. Lampworking in short is the art of melting glass on to a very round and small mandrel which is what makes the bead hole. Then the bead is cooled to room temp. that is done with a digital kiln. I always clean my beads with a sharp diamond drill bit. I am picky about the way my beads look so I take a lot of pride in makeing each one in my studio in Texas.
